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Catford to Ystrad Mynach start from as little as £27.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Catford to Ystrad Mynach start from £102.50 one way, or £87.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Catford to Ystrad Mynach are available for £82.40 one way, or £299.00 return

Facilities and Amenities at Catford Station

Catford station is well-equipped to make your journey as comfortable and seamless as possible. The ticket office is open from 06:40 to 20:25 on weekdays, with slightly reduced hours on weekends. The presence of ticket machines facilitates easy collection of tickets purchased online. Those with accessibility requirements will be pleased to know that Thameslink ticket machines support Disabled Persons Railcard discounts and the station ensures step-free access throughout. Additionally, for auditory-impaired passengers, the station offers an induction loop.

With CCTV surveillance and many help points located throughout the station, Catford ensures a sense of safety and assistance is always available. This makes it convenient for travelers who might need guidance or help during their journey. However, you might want to plan ahead as the station lacks some amenities like a waiting room or restroom facilities. But don't worry there's more to enjoy in the vicinity!

Accessibility and Assistance

The station prides itself on being accessible to passengers with disabilities, offering step-free access throughout and accessible ticket machines. A ramp operated by staff is available for train access, ensuring that all passengers can board efficiently. It's essential to know that tactile surfaces may not cover all platform edges, so do reach out for assistance if needed. For those looking for guidance without prior booking, the station provides an efficient "turn up and go" service to help as needed.

Station Facilities and Ticketing Options

When you set foot in Ystrad Mynach station, you'll find convenient ticket buying options. The ticket office is open on weekdays from 06:30 to 13:00 and on Saturdays from 08:00 to 14:30, perfect for early morning travelers. For those who prefer self-service, ticket machines are available and allow for online ticket collection. However, it's worth noting that machines do not accept cash, so be sure to have your debit or credit card handy.

This station takes accessibility seriously, offering step-free access throughout. There are lifts available for access to Platform 1 towards Cardiff, and a direct step-free route from the car park to Platform 2 heading to Rhymney. With customers' ease and movement in mind, induction loops are provided, and ramps are available for train access, although facilities like waiting rooms and accessible toilets are lacking.

Amenities and Support Services

Ystrad Mynach station offers essential services such as customer help points and information from staff at the ticket office and help points. CCTV coverage ensures added security, although there is no dedicated luggage storage facility. For those tech-savvy travelers, public Wi-Fi is accessible, giving you the chance to keep connected while you travel. You can explore other hotspots near the station on various Wi-Fi services.

Parking and Cycling

The station car park, open 24 hours daily, accommodates 34 spaces, with three designated for accessible parking, and it's free of charge. For cycling enthusiasts, Ystrad Mynach provides 36 bicycle spaces with covered and secure stands monitored by CCTV. While there are no cycle hire facilities, these amenities support environmentally friendly travel options.

Transport Links and Travel Options

The station's connection doesn't end with the train. Rail replacement bus services use the Blackwood Link bus stop in the station's car park, ensuring smooth transitions to different travel modes.
